spreedly_sca_show_provider

Read-only

Retrieves detailed information about a specific SCA provider using its unique token.

Instructions

Retrieves details of an SCA provider. This tool ONLY reads data.

Input Schema

TableJSON Schema
NameRequiredDescriptionDefault
sca_provider_tokenYesThe token of the SCA provider
